Ten finalists have been chosen from a pool of more than 200 nominees for the 51st annual Vlogƽ Alumni Association Distinguished Teaching Award.
The Vlogƽ Alumni Association recognizes Vlogƽ faculty members with this award annually. The Distinguished Teaching Award is the most esteemed honor that Vlogƽ grants to three full-time, tenure-track faculty members. In order to be nominated, faculty members must have been employed at the university for at least seven years and be in a tenured or tenure-track position.

The events of May 4, 1970, placed Vlogƽ in an international spotlight after a student protest against the Vietnam War and the presence of the Ohio National Guard ended in tragedy with four students losing their lives and nine others being wounded. From a perspective of nearly 50 years, Vlogƽ remembers the tragedy and leads a contemporary discussion and understanding of how the community, nation and world can benefit from understanding the profound impact of the event.
